Geologic descriptionNative copper and malachite and azurite stains are present at two localities in basalt that is locally amygdaloidal. Azurite and malachite is present in breccia zone in Devonian or older dolomite overlying the basalt. These dolomite unit is likely part of the Katakturuk Dolomite which depositionally overlies the basalt in which the copper is present. The Katakturuk Dolomite is considered Proterozoic in age and hence the basalt also likely is Proterozoic in age. | |
